Broomy Hill Pumping Station
This is the new extension to The Waterworks Museum, Hereford. It was officially inaugurated on 25-6-06 and Sir Neil Cossons of EH was present. I gatecrashed the party and was made most welcome. You can compare this to the earlier photograph from the same corner.
